Maximize Your Retirement Savings

Maximizing your retirement savings requires a strategic approach and disciplined planning. Here are some effective strategies:

1. Start Early

The earlier you start saving, the more time your money has to grow through compound interest. Even small contributions can accumulate significantly over time.

2. Contribute to Retirement Accounts

Take full advantage of tax-advantaged accounts such as a 401(k) or an IRA. If your employer offers a match, contribute enough to receive the full benefit.

3. Increase Contributions Gradually

As you receive raises or bonuses, consider increasing your retirement contributions. This step can lead to substantial growth over the years.

4. Diversify Investments

Investing in a diversified portfolio reduces risks and enhances growth potential. Consider a mix of stocks, bonds, and mutual funds suited to your risk tolerance.

5. Minimize Fees

High fees can erode your savings. Choose low-cost investment options and be mindful of expense ratios in mutual funds and ETFs.

6. Regularly Review Your Plan

Periodically assess your investment strategy and financial goals. Adjust your contributions and investments as needed to stay on track.

7. Seek Professional Advice

If you're unsure how to proceed, consult a financial advisor. They can provide personalized advice tailored to your retirement objectives.

By implementing these strategies, you can effectively maximize your retirement savings, securing a comfortable financial future.
